Dallas Stars' final offer to Chris Tanev finally revealed
The Chris Tanev sweepstakes came down to Toronto and Dallas, and we now know what the Stars were offering and why the Maple Leafs nabbed him.
Toronto native Chris Tanev signed a 6-year pact with the Maple Leafs on July 1st, paying him $4.5M per season over than span. Tanev's former club, the Dallas Stars, apparently made a final push to retain the coveted stay at home defender, falling short to the Leafs.
As per Nick Kypreos of the Toronto Star, the Stars and Leafs were not all that far apart on the AAV, with the term being the clincher for Toronto. Kypreos said this week that the Stars were offering Tanev $5M per season.
''The Stars weren't in the same ballpark as the Leafs to entice Tanev to re-sign there. Their best offer was $15 million over three years.''
While the Stars offered a higher AAV than the Maple Leafs, the added years and the potential of playing for his hometown club enticed the defensive defenseman man to sign with the blue and white.
With this significant investment on defence, the Leafs are headed into the 2024-25 season with their most well-rounded D corps in perhaps the last 20 years.
